## Formula sandbox tuning

User-supplied formulas in Gridmoor execute inside a restricted interpreter with hard ceilings on time, memory, and call depth. Reviewers should confirm any change to these ceilings is justified in the PR description, since raising them widens the abuse surface. Defaults were chosen from production traces. The current limits are as follows.

limits module of tafog-fawip:
WEIGHTS = {
    "julix": 57,
    "lamys": 992,
    "kasvan": 209,
    "quenok": 750,
    "alddor": 259,
    "oliath": 1009,
    "wenix": 815,
}

- [ ] Verify undo/redo in Sketchloom diagram editor. Steps: create three shapes, move one, delete one, undo five times, redo five times. Canvas must match original state exactly. Known prior issue: connector labels lost on redo — fixed in this release. If a customer reports history corruption, collect their session log and confirm they're on the patched build. Support should reference the verified build token below when triaging.

trace token, fafog-kageg: htk4_98e6

Release step 7: run the orphaned-resource sweeper (Gleanbot) in dry-run mode against the Harrowfield staging cluster. Review the candidate list; anything older than 14 days with no owner tag is fair game. Confirm with the on-call before live deletion. Log the sweep summary in the release thread. Record the trace token emitted at the end of the dry run directly below this line.

session token of tajef-bageg = htk21_5d90d574934f3ccae6437